About Lower Shellbourne Spring
Lower Shellbourne Spring offers a tranquil escape in the Nevada wilderness, where warm waters pool at a soothing 77°F. This primitive warm spring captivates with its natural surroundings, inviting you to immerse yourself in an authentic outdoor soaking experience away from crowds.
Getting There
Reaching Lower Shellbourne Spring requires a bit of adventure, as access involves a rugged hike through uneven terrain. Parking is limited near the trailhead, so prepare for a moderate walk that rewards you with peaceful, untouched scenery typical of Nevada's swimming holes.
What to Expect
The spring’s gently warm waters provide a comfortable temperature for soaking without overwhelming heat. You’ll find a quiet atmosphere, embraced by native vegetation and the sounds of the desert, with no developed facilities nearby—emphasizing the primitive character of the spot.
Tips for Visitors
Visit during the cooler parts of the day to enjoy the spring without strong desert sun. Bring plenty of water, sturdy footwear, and be prepared to pack out all trash, as there are no amenities or fees. Respect the fragile environment to preserve this natural treasure among Nevada hot springs.
